About the Role
As an SEN Behavioural Mentor, you will work closely with pupils who experience social, emotional, or behavioural challenges. You will provide consistent, structured support to help learners regulate their emotions, make positive choices, and re‑engage with learning.
You will work across both classroom and pastoral environments, offering 1:1 intervention, small‑group SEMH support, and behaviour mentoring tailored to each pupil’s needs.
Key Responsibilities
- Provide targeted 1:1 behaviour mentoring to pupils with SEMH and behavioural needs.
- Support pupils with emotional regulation using trauma‑informed and therapeutic approaches.
- Deliver structured interventions focusing on self‑esteem, communication, resilience, and behaviour.
- Build trusting, safe relationships with pupils to encourage positive engagement.
- Support teachers in managing behaviour and maintaining a calm, purposeful learning environment.
- Implement strategies outlined in EHCPs, risk assessments, and behaviour plans.
- Use de‑escalation and positive behaviour support strategies consistently.
- Assist pupils during transitions, unstructured times, and off‑site activities.
- Work collaboratively with teachers, the SENCO, pastoral teams, and external professionals.
